Output 58e64b89696d8f56e9585dc41aeb66b6960786c8a371cc0b182803a7bf244eaf:1

value
7527684
script pubkey
OP_0 OP_PUSHBYTES_20 d986306716158315aba66d29fe544cbc8455bb1b
address
bc1qmxrrqeckzkp3t2axd55lu4zvhjz9twcmtf2rus
transaction
58e64b89696d8f56e9585dc41aeb66b6960786c8a371cc0b182803a7bf244eaf
spent
true